在数字化时代,UI(用户界面)设计的重要性不言而喻。一个美观、高效的用户界面不仅能够提升用户体验,还能增强产品的市场竞争力。本文将带你从基础到实战,全面解析UI组件设计,让你设计的界面更加美观高效。
一、UI组件设计基础
1.1 UI组件的定义
UI组件是构成用户界面的基本元素,如按钮、输入框、下拉菜单等。它们是用户与产品交互的桥梁,直接影响用户体验。
1.2 UI组件设计原则
- 一致性:组件风格、颜色、字体等应保持一致,避免用户产生困惑。
- 简洁性:避免过多的装饰和动画,保持界面简洁明了。
- 易用性:组件操作简单,便于用户快速上手。
- 响应性:组件在不同设备上都能良好展示。
1.3 常见UI组件
- 按钮:用于执行操作,如提交、取消等。
- 输入框:用于接收用户输入,如姓名、密码等。
- 下拉菜单:用于选择选项,如城市、日期等。
- 单选框、复选框:用于选择多个选项。
- 图标:用于表示功能,如搜索、刷新等。
二、UI组件设计实战
2.1 设计流程
- 需求分析:明确产品功能、目标用户等。
- 竞品分析:参考同类产品,分析其优缺点。
- 界面布局:确定组件位置、大小、间距等。
- 视觉设计:选择颜色、字体、图标等元素。
- 交互设计:确定组件的交互方式,如点击、滑动等。
- 测试与优化:收集用户反馈,不断优化设计。
2.2 设计工具
- Sketch:适用于移动端UI设计。
- Adobe XD:适用于移动端和网页端UI设计。
- Figma:适用于团队协作的UI设计。
2.3 实战案例
案例一:登录界面
- 需求分析:用户需要输入用户名和密码登录。
- 界面布局:将用户名和密码输入框放置在顶部,下方为登录按钮。
- 视觉设计:使用简洁的线条和图标,提高界面美观度。
- 交互设计:点击登录按钮,验证用户名和密码。
- 测试与优化:根据用户反馈,调整输入框大小和位置。
案例二:购物车界面
- 需求分析:用户需要查看购物车中的商品、数量和总价。
- 界面布局:将商品图片、名称、数量和价格等信息展示在列表中。
- 视觉设计:使用不同的颜色和图标区分商品类型。
- 交互设计:点击商品,可查看详细信息;点击删除,可移除商品。
- 测试与优化:根据用户反馈,优化商品列表的排序和筛选功能。
三、总结
UI组件设计是提升用户体验的关键。通过本文的解析,相信你已经对UI组件设计有了更深入的了解。在实际操作中,不断积累经验,提高自己的设计水平,让你的界面更加美观高效。
